Body

Origins and Family

Catherine Harpur's father was Sir John Harpur, 4th Bt.[4]. Her mother was Catherine Crewe[5].

Personal Life

Among Catherine Harpur's spouses was Sir Henry Gough, 1st Baronet[6].

Death and Burial

Catherine Harpur died on +1740-06-22T00:00:00Z[2]. She is buried at St Bartholomew's Church, Edgbaston[3].
